Why Eggs Make Me Tired: Causes & Solutions

Many people report that after eating eggs they feel unusually tired or drained, often questioning whether breakfast is helping or hindering their energy. This article explores why eggs might lead to fatigue and what you can do about it.

Below you will find a quick reference that summarizes key patterns, causes, and practical fixes related to eggs making you tired.

Why Eggs Might Trigger Fatigue

Protein Load and Digestion Demand

Eggs are protein dense, and processing a large protein load requires significant digestive and metabolic effort. Blood flow shifts toward the gastrointestinal tract, which can create a temporary feeling of tiredness.

Cooking Method and Nutrient Retention

Overcooked eggs may form more advanced glycation end products and reduce certain B vitamins that help energy production. Gentle cooking methods like soft boiling or steaming may reduce post meal fatigue.

Timing and Meal Composition

Breakfast Context and Blood Sugar Balance

When eggs dominate a low fiber, low carb breakfast, blood sugar can rise and then drop quickly. Pairing eggs with vegetables, whole grains, or legumes creates a steadier energy curve.

Portion Size and Satiety Signals

A very large portion of eggs at one sitting can trigger a strong postprandial response, including the release of compounds that promote rest and digest activity. Adjusting portion size often reduces extreme tiredness.

Lifestyle and Underlying Conditions

Thyroid Function and Metabolic Rate

Reduced thyroid activity can slow processing of dietary protein and change how your body responds to a high protein meal, potentially making tiredness worse after eggs.

Medication and Medical History

Certain medications and metabolic conditions can alter amino acid and protein handling, so the same egg portion may affect energy differently from person to person.

Practical Adjustments for Sustained Energy

  • Balance each serving of eggs with fiber rich vegetables and whole grains.
  • Choose fresh eggs and cook them using gentler methods like soft boiling.
  • Adjust portion size to what comfortably supports your energy without heaviness.
  • Track timing and context to identify your personal patterns around egg consumption.
